Instructional Strategies
We employ a number of instructional strategies in our Studio Art Classes:
Teacher-guided demonstrations of art processes and techniques
Class discussion on visual art examples, works of art criticism and art history
Teacher lecture on art history and philosophy
Student-led demonstrations of art processes and techniques
Group critiques of student artwork
Regular sketchbook practice
Practical exercise work in drawing/painting/sculpture techniques
Backwards planning for sustained, multiple-step projects
Independent project work with one-on-one teacher check-ins
Video documentary and interviews with artists; artist working processes; demonstrations of art techniques
Teacher-guided brainstorming and creative-problem-solving
